Installation Tips
- As a general rule, exterior wall mounted lights should be hung 1/3 of the distance down from the height of the door or garage door opening.
- For Example: Door height is 9', Light Fixtures should be installed 6-7' from the floor.
- When installing a light next to a door, try to hang the light fixture on the door handle side of the opening.
- Use 2 people when installing lights. It is helpful to have one person hold the light while the other connects the wiring and brackets.
- Silicone is a good idea around the base of the light after installation. It will keep water and bugs from entering behind the light fixture.
- Use LED bulbs whenever possible. They are energy efficient and last for a very long time.
- Try to purchase led bulbs in a color temperatur range of 2700K - 3500K. This is a warm and inviting color. Colors above 3500K tend to look very blue and cold.

Helpful Information
- The bottom of this outdoor wall light is open. To change light bulbs simply reach up through the bottom to replace.
- Outdoor lights that are UL listed for wet or damp locations can be used indoors as well.
- This item is not dark sky compliant as light can shine out and up from the clear glass front.
